Virginia “Ginny” Bailey

May 27, 2025

Virginia (Ginny) was born in Waverly, NY, January 21, 1932. Daughter of Nina Dunbar and Mason Morey Virginia grew up in the Elmira area. She was married to her husband for 61 years, Daniel Sr. Daniel Bailey and Virginia had a wonderful son Daniel Jr. who passed away in 2010, her husband passed away in 2011. Virginia retired from Jamesway in 1987. Her family was everything to her, she loved working in her yard and having her grandson Bill and Cailin visiting her, she was always there for her family when needed. Virginia was a great grandma to Declan, Braeden, and Rowan, her grandson Bill and wife Cailin. She loved her nieces and nephews they were just a help and joy to her. She was predeceased by her siblings, Mason Morey Jr., John Morey, Florence Lagstrom, Violet DeGraw, Jane Forbes, Ruth Bailey, Marjorie Laird, Fred Morey and Robert Morey Sr.. She had wonderful neighbors who watched over her and were so helpful to her.
